
Lydia Holland

Lydia Holland is a New York City–based dancer, singer, and actor. A graduate of the Theater Arts Preparatory School in Las Vegas, she began her professional career at Tuacahn Amphitheatre, where she performed in Mary Poppins,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at, and Wonderland as a swing.
She returned to Tuacahn the following season to perform in Tarzan as Assistant Dance Captain and Swing, The Hunchback of Notre Dame, and the regional premiere of Charlie and the Chocolate Factory. Most recently, Lydia appeared in Mean Girls at Pittsburgh CLO.
With training in a wide range of dance styles, Lydia is a versatile performer who brings energy, precision, and heart to every production. In addition to performing, she has experience teaching and choreographing around the US.
